Here’s some of what’s going on in and around Woodridge for Tuesday, July 30.
---
· The Woodridge Chamber of Commerce is holding a ribbon-cutting ceremony for National Title Solutions, Inc. (3550 Hobson Rd., Woodridge) at 1:00 p.m., with refreshments following the celebration; all are invited.

· Resident Debbie Kennedy reports having found a cat on Alden Lane in Darien (just outside Woodridge) last week on July 24. No picture, but the kitty is described as a tortoiseshell, about six months old and weighing six pounds. If anyone lost such a cat, call 630-910-1845.
· Got a passion for roadwork? The Village of Woodridge is promoting the Illinois Tollway’s 2013 Construction Careers Expo that runs from 1:00 p.m. to 5:00 p.m. at the Aurora campus of Waubonsee Community College (18 S River St, Aurora) “Various organizations will be available to answer questions and provide information on how to get started in a roadway construction career,” the Village post reads.
